How does a wind turbine convert kinetic energy into electrical energy?

Wind turbine (WT) has blades connected to the mechanical shaft through gearbox and rotor hub. It converts kinetic energy of the wind into mechanical energy of the shaft. The shaft drives the generator to convert the mechanical energy into electrical energy . The energy contained by the wind depends on the wind velocity (v) and air density (ρ).

How Do Wind Turbines Synchronize To The Grid?

Wind turbines are connected to the grid in a variety of ways. The electricity generated by the wind turbine generator is sent to a transmission substation, where it is transformed to extremely high voltage (between 155,000 and 765,000 volts) for transmission across great distances on the transmission system.

How offshore wind turbines are connected to the grid

Offshore wind turbines are interconnected through an array of cables that transmit power to a central offshore substation. The substation acts as a hub, aggregating the energy produced by multiple turbines. From there, subsea export cables transport the power onshore, where it is distributed through the local grid connection system.

How Wind Energy Became Integral to the Modern Grid

As a result, the variability of energy output decreases as wind power plants cover a larger geographic area. For example, a single wind turbine''s output changes in response to local wind variations, but the many turbines in a 100-megawatt (MW) plant each experience different winds at any given moment.
